Other Options: Two added solutions exist that are particular to osteoarthritis pain — Adequan® and Librela®. Adequan (polysulfated glycosaminoglycan) can be an injectable drug that helps beat lack of cartilage and restore the lubrication of joints.

Acupuncture: Acupuncture may have a spot in equally acute and Long-term pain management for dogs. Little needles are placed into the body in specific factors to set off the release of endorphins. Laser therapy: Laser therapy encourages restore of injured tissues. Laser treatments result in the release of endorphins, improved blood stream in a very region, relaxation of muscles, lessened inflammation, and faster therapeutic. Laser therapy may be used for a wide range of circumstances, including surgical incision healing or Continual arthritis. Massage: Massage can relieve muscle stiffness and spasms that trigger pain. Look for somebody who focuses on canine massage therapy. A canine information therapist might also have the ability to tell you about at-household massages you are able to complete for your Puppy. Hydrotherapy: Hydrotherapy can refer to certain types of Actual physical therapy or to the use of running h2o more than wounds.

8. Lorazepam (Ativan) Employed in dogs for: situational anxiety, phobias, dread anxiety, worry disorders Lorazepam is a brief-performing medication that normally takes impact in about thirty minutes. Every time achievable lorazepam should be specified to dogs ahead of time of the party that is understood to induce anxiety. The drug can even be supplied within the earliest signal that a Puppy is becoming anxious. This medication shouldn't be stopped abruptly Should you have been giving it towards your dog extended-expression. This medication is classified being a benzodiazepine and is effective by promoting g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) action in the Mind. GABA inhibits the results of excitatory nerve alerts during the brain, resulting in a calming impact on your pet. Prospective side effects might include things like: Grogginess Sedation Lack of equilibrium Increased appetite Enjoyment Intense behavior 9. Paroxetine (Paxil) Employed in dogs for: generalized anxiety, nervous aggression and anxiety-associated behaviors, fear of noises Paroxetine is often a member in the selective serotonin-re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) course of remedies, which protect against receptors in the Mind from eliminating the anxious system chemical messenger serotonin. This permits for increased serotonin ranges within the Mind. Paroxetine can take four to 6 months to take impact and should be offered after day by day.
